Meanwhile, a one-day seminar titled “The impact of Interfaith Programs in Pakistani Universities on Religious Tolerance and Understanding” was organized by the Islamia University of Bahawalpur with the support of Punjab Higher Education Commission at Ghulam Muhammad Ghotvi Hall, Abbasia Campus. Dr. Tanveer Qasim, Director Coordination Punjab Higher Education Commission has said that inter-faith harmony is the guarantee of social and economic development. Extremist behavior and hateful thinking are leading us to decline. For the improvement of the society, the research done in the university should be beneficial for the state. Our religion and Prophet Muhammad (PBUH) teaches us mutual respect, patience and tolerance. The main purpose of universities is to provide scientific solutions to the current problems of the society. Fifty-five percent of the world’s population consists of followers of Islam and Christianity. Through the promotion of dialogue and harmony, the ways of establishing peace in the world can be paved. We need to research Islamophobia as well as Muslimphobia.

Dr. Akmal Soomro, Public Relations Officer, University of Home Economics, Lahore, said that there should be research on the topics of promoting peace and tolerance in universities so that the society can benefit from it. Prof. Dr. Sheikh Shafiq ur Rehman Dean Faculty of Islamic and Arabic Studies the Islamia University of Bahawalpur while addressing the participants of the seminar said that we should promote inter-faith harmony as well as inter-religious harmony. He said that the universities should organize academic and intellectual training for the promotion of religious tolerance among the youth.
